Who is Volstagg the Enormous?

Volstagg the Enormous is a boastful, rotund Asgardian warrior and proud member of the Warriors Three, adventuring alongside Fandral and Hogun. Despite his legendary appetite and comical bravado, he is a genuine fighter who stands among Thor's most loyal companions in the halls of Asgard.

Few characters in Marvel's cosmic mythology carry both a battle-axe and a feast with equal devotion — Volstagg the Enormous burst onto the Silver Age scene in Thor #129 (1966), conjured by the legendary duo of Stan Lee and Jack Kirby. A proud member of the Warriors Three and the broader pantheon of Asgardian Gods, this larger-than-life figure has shared the halls of Asgard and the pages of Thor alongside immortals like Odin, Thor Odinson, and his inseparable companions Hogun the Grim and Fandral the Dashing for over five decades.
